The Sylva-Igiri Campaign Organization of the All Progressives Congress (APC) has frowned at a statement credited to Dickson Restoration Campaign Organisation, that the APC was behind the recent kidnap of a younger sister to Governor Seriake Dickson.
In a statement signed by Chief Nathan Egba, the Director of Media and Publicity of the Sylva-Igiri Campaign Organization of the All Progressives Congress (APC), has frowned at a statement credited to Dickson Restoration Campaign Organisation, that the APC was behind the recent kidnap of a younger sister to Governor Seriake Dickson.
In the statement which was made available to DailyPost on Sunday, the Sylva-Igiri Campaign Organization described the accusations as ‘the most stupid statement ever issued by anybody.’
“While we sympathise with the Dickson’s family and condemn in very strong terms the kidnap of the young lady, we want to also condemn the irresponsible statement from the PDP Campaign spokesman, Jonathan Obuebite.

We are sure Obuebite Jonathan didn’t even realise that by this statement, the PDP was clearly ‎admitting their involvement in the recent kidnapping of family members and business associates of the APC Candidate, Chief Timipre Sylva and his running mate, Elder Wilberforce Igiri.

So is the PDP saying that having carried out these kidnappings, including that of the Wife of Rt. Hon. Nestor Binabo, the APC is now retaliating by orchestrating the kidnap of Gov. Dickson’s Sister?

People need to reason like educated adults and stop making all manner of statements with a view to scoring cheap political points,” Egba warned.
The APC governorship campaign spokesman maintained that Bayelsans are not ruling out the possibility of the ruling PDP government stage-managing the kidnap saga, with a view to attracting sympathy from Southern Ijaw voters.
